The Mississagi Briefly in Windsor

While I was waiting for the Cuyahoga, I saw that the Mississagi was making her way up the River.  I wasn't sure if I would catch her before I got to the park, but I did.
 While I thought she was docking on the Windsor side, it turns that she really wasn't.  Because of the nuances in the Jones Act, she had to touch Canadian soil before heading to the spot where she was unloading.
 Even though I saw her not too long ago, it is always nice to see a classic laker.
